Scientists have now crossed a threshold that until recently belonged to science fiction. Using artificial intelligence, researchers have successfully designed and assembled a fully synthetic virus—one that has no natural ancestor and was generated from scratch by an AI system. Known as LIFE (Learning-based Iterative Functional Evolution), the virus was created by training an algorithm to predict how genetic changes would affect viral function, then allowing it to iteratively “evolve” its own design. The result was a lab-grown virus capable of infecting living bacteria, not copied from nature but conceived digitally and brought to life in a controlled environment.
While researchers insist this particular virus poses no threat to humans, animals, or plants, the implications extend far beyond the laboratory. AI was able to explore millions of genetic combinations at speeds no human team could match, refining viral traits through repeated cycles of learning and synthesis. What is being framed as a medical breakthrough—potentially useful for combating antibiotic-resistant bacteria—also exposes a sobering reality: intelligence is no longer merely studying life, it is designing it. The same tools that optimize helpful organisms could just as easily be redirected toward more harmful ends if placed in the wrong hands or deployed without restraint.
